The Path of Light
The Path of Light
When shadows creep across my weary heart
And storms of sorrow rage and tear apart
The fragile peace I’ve struggled to maintain
While walking through this valley of cold rain
I search for light to pierce the darkest clouds,
A single ray to part those banked up shrouds,
And there, a lone bright flower blooms despite the strife -
A lesson that renews my will to thrive.
Within the petals, hope reveals its face,
Defying gloom with wild tenacious grace,
Proving that along the roughest roads we tread
There are still wonders waiting to be spread.
It takes but one sweet bird’s exuberant song
Toflood my soul with promise, clear and strong -
A glimpse of joy when I least expect its glow
Can drown out grief and wash away the woe.
Each minor blessing grants me strength to say -
I will not yield or crumple come what may.
Armed by these gifts that brighten dreary days
I can withstand the trial’s test and blaze.
My heart will sing though ravaged by the storms,
Through clouds, I’ll see the sun’s returning forms,
For pain and fear shall never fully smother
The irrepressible joy of life and living.
So in this lung-dark night I will not quail,
The dawn will come, and hope will still prevail.
If I press on, while steeped in sorrow’s mire,
I’ll find redemption rising from the muck and mire.
And when I gaze back on my winding trail,
These lessons learned will make the journey’s tale -
That joy persists if we hold fast and learn to see
In simple moments life’s sweet victory.
